Senate Bill 1233 of 2010 (Public Act 241 of 2010)

Sponsors

Categories

Economic development: brownfield redevelopment authority; Transportation: funds
Economic development; brownfield redevelopment authority; incentives to invest in transit-oriented facilities and transit-oriented development; provide for. Amends sec. 2 of 1996 PA 381 (MCL 125.2652).
